Definition

Acronym

  • Naval Air Training and Operating Procedures Standardization

Origin

Modern. From around 1961.

Comments

Pronounced “Nay Tops.” Simply put, a training program detailing procedures for air operations in general, and for specific naval aircraft with the aim of reducing accidents and improving combat effectiveness. There are multiple NATOPS manuals, such as ones for individual aircraft. It’s been said that each manual has been written in blood.
